SCOTTISH REGENCY MAHOGANY CARD TABLE

SCOTTISH REGENCY MAHOGANY CARD TABLE EARLY 19TH CENTURY the crossbanded fold-over top with a beaded edge, opening to a green baize playing surface, above a bead moulded panel frieze, raised on a tapered square column and concave quadripartite base on scrolled feet with brass castors 93cm wide, 76cm high, 46cm deep The Estate of Eric Robinson

A Regency mahogany card table,

A Regency mahogany card table, c.1810, the foldover top with canted corners, and satinwood crossbanding, opening to reveal a baize-lined top, above an inlaid frieze, on ring turned column and outswept fluted quatreform supports, terminating in brass lion paw castors 91cm wide closed, 45cm deep, open, 89.5cm deep 72cm high Condition Report: With later baize. AN EXCEPTIONAL AND RARE SUITE OF TWO REGENCY CARD TABLES AND A SOFA TABLE

AN EXCEPTIONAL AND RARE SUITE OF TWO REGENCY CARD TABLES AND A SOFA TABLE Each with gadrooned edges and carved neoclassical medallions on a gunbarrel pedestal and quadraform base with stylised lion's paw feet on concealed castors. In mahogany and with mahogany veneers. English circa 1820. Card tables: 73.5 x 91 x 44.5cm, sofa table: 73.5 x 151 x 68cm PROVENANCE: Martyn Cook Antiques,Sydney 1982

AN EXTREMELY FINE AND RARE FEDERAL CARVED MAHOGANY AND SATINWOOD MARBLE-TOP PIER TABLE, ATTRIBUTED TO DUNCAN PHYFE, NEW YORK, CIRCA 1805,

the shaped white marble top with reeded edge above a figured satinwood frieze centering a rectangular reserve carved with swags and tassels tied with a bowknot, four flowerhead-carved dies flanking, a brass beaded molding below hung with turned pendants above a fluted, reeded and waterleaf-carved urn-form standard on reeded down-curving legs ending in carved animal paw feet.
